Transaction 2b2656f40d33f202dbca280c2ae6401bc79b243a868e45f79d9a5d1da6f950c1

1 Input
2 Outputs
  • 2b2656f40d33f202dbca280c2ae6401bc79b243a868e45f79d9a5d1da6f950c1:0
  • value  2647414
    address  14mh9Dd8P6czB5hDWhRcpK1fCNaRznTGh3
  • 2b2656f40d33f202dbca280c2ae6401bc79b243a868e45f79d9a5d1da6f950c1:1
  • value  17385
    address  143nUQjid8KnnffnwA2TimFMxtGAGCPBMk